Transaction 320e51430f28e6a5e10f82c3ae18e0135ece4f8304a4e32e3440ef46d1969141
2 Input
2 Outputs
- 320e51430f28e6a5e10f82c3ae18e0135ece4f8304a4e32e3440ef46d1969141:0
- 320e51430f28e6a5e10f82c3ae18e0135ece4f8304a4e32e3440ef46d1969141:1
value 442366
address 14gMmbLRh8TH85cFP4qAe1JEnNjEiS5p2r
value 8248788
address 34HMGMo2VX1zfKtoDGwcYorDqvfpvj9xMG